Youth Design Camp to create concepts for Peavey Park picnic shelter

June 27, 2017 @ 9:00 am - 12:00 pm

What  

This two-day design camp is a unique opportunity for young people to help design a picnic shelter for Peavey Park! Through hands-on activities, they will focus on the potential design for a picnic shelter and learn how an architectural project moves from the idea stage to become a concept, a plan, and finally, an actual built structure. 

Who

Youth ages 13 to 17 in the Phillips neighborhood

Adults are welcome to observe and will be asked not to participate. 

Where

Hope Academy, 2300 Chicago Avenue, Minneapolis, just south of Peavey Park. Enter at the doors on Chicago Avenue. 

When

Tuesday, June 27 and Thursday, June 29, from 9 am to 12 noon each day.

Light morning refreshments and box lunches will be provided.
